e-Nijukti: Online Job Portal for State Employment Mission in readiness

The unemployed youths of the state will now have a smile on their face as they need not worry to search for a job.

Odisha State Employment Mission (OSEM) is going ahead to have a web based portal for imparting skill based  training to less  qualified  & unskilled youths for skilled jobs like Fitter, Mali, Driver, Electrician and many more.

Job seekers can apply online for getting training free of cost through the portal and can accordingly choose the training institute of the relevant sector of their choice.

A candidate can get enrolled into a course offered by a Govt. recognized training institute of PIA (Project Implementing Agency) online. Once candidate gets enrolled and completes training as per Govt. guidelines, it becomes the responsibility of the PIA to ensure a job for the candidate. PIA has to provide jobs to at least 75% of its total strength in a training batch.

This online system will facilitate job providers to recruit  the trained job seekers. SMS alert is integrated through this system so that job seekers, PIA can get SMS alert.

OSEM  and NIC (National Informatics Centre) are jointly working to implement the portal in the state.

An in-house training programme was organised for the officials of OSEM, PIAs, District Employment Officers (DEOs) at NIC Odisha State Centre, Bhubaneswar from 1st February 2013 to 2nd February 2013.

The Commissioner-cum-Secretary, ETET department  Shri C. S. Kumar, IAS &  Shri Hemant Kumar Sharma, IAS Commissioner-cum-Director, Employment are taking the lead role in  making this project a grand success. In a review meeting by Chief Secretary, this online system was widely appreciated and it has been decided that other 4 department, that are doing similar type of jobs through other agencies should be a part of NIC developed system.

This Mission Critical Project of Odisha is likely to be formally lunched soon.
